DS Flash Equipment > how do you do wireless multiboot?

#154667 - Alphanoob - Sun Apr 20, 2008 2:43 am

The topic pretty much explains it, I hope that this is the right spot to post. Basically, I am using a flashed NDS lite with a supercard lite in it, and was just curious as to how wmb works. Anyone wanna help me out?

#154670 - Sektor - Sun Apr 20, 2008 3:55 am

You can use it as a method of sending from a PC to the DS. If you are running Windows then you need a PCI/Cardbus wi-fi card with a RT2560 chipset. Install the driver and WMB Application and then run WMB.exe -data file.nds.

Boot the DS, select "Download Play" and wait for the game to show up.

does the router thing still function as a normal one too? Or would I just be better off using my card normally?

#154674 - Sektor - Sun Apr 20, 2008 5:42 am

ralink cards can only be used for WMB when Firefly's driver is enabled. You have to switch back to normal driver if you want to use it as a normal wi-fi card. Firefly's driver doesn't support USB ralink cards, so you can't use the Nintendo Wi-fi connector.
